The Spatial and Temporal Characteristics of Precipitation in The Inland Region of Qinghai Province

The inland region of Qinghai Province is located in the northwestern part of the province. The region is in arid and rainless environment, where the precipitation is spatial maldistribution. According to the third-level zoning of water resources in the inland region of northwest China, the inland region of Qinghai Province can be divided into three sub-regions: the western Qaidam Basin, the eastern Qaidam Basin and the Qinghai Lake water system region. The precipitation in these three sub-regions decreases from east to west. In this paper, linear fitting method, Mann-Kendall test method and Morlet wavelet analysis method were used to analyze the annual change of precipitation data from 1956 to 2013 in the inland region of Qinghai Province and three sub-regions, and the mutations and the periodic characteristics of the annual series were measured and analyzed. The results of linear fitting method indicate that the precipitation in the inland region of Qinghai Province is increasing during this period, with the strongest trend in the eastern Qaidam Basin and the weakest in the western Qaidam Basin. The results of the Mann-Kendall test method indicate that the precipitation in the inland region of Qinghai Province changed abruptly in 1984 and presented a marked upward trend after 1986. An abrupt change of precipitation of the western Qaidam Basin was identified in 1962, and as for eastern Qaidam Basin the abrupt change happened in 1984. A marked upward trend of precipitation of the western Qaidam Basin occurred during 1970-1995 and after 2007, as for eastern Qaidam Basin the trend happened after 1986. There were no abrupt change and significant upward trend in the Qinghai Lake water system region. The results of Morlet wavelet analysis method indicate that the precipitation in the inland region of Qinghai Province shows periodic "increasing-decreasing" oscillations, the first main cycle is 22 years, and the second and third cycles are 16 years and 8 years. For the western Qaidam Basin, the first main cycle is 32 years, the second cycle is 7 years. For the eastern Qaidam Basin, the first main cycle is 26 years, the second and third cycle is 15 years and 9 years. For the Qinghai Lake water system region, the first main cycle is 26 years.
